Add device limits as sysfs entries,
        - copy_max_bytes (RW)
        - copy_max_hw_bytes (RO)

Above limits help to split the copy payload in block layer.
copy_max_bytes: maximum total length of copy in single payload.
copy_max_hw_bytes: Reflects the device supported maximum limit.

+What:          /sys/block/<disk>/queue/copy_max_bytes
+Date:          May 2024
+Contact:       linux-bl...@vger.kernel.org
+Description:
+               [RW] This is the maximum number of bytes that the block layer
+               will allow for a copy request. This is always smaller or
+               equal to the maximum size allowed by the hardware, indicated by
+               'copy_max_hw_bytes'. An attempt to set a value higher than
+               'copy_max_hw_bytes' will truncate this to 'copy_max_hw_bytes'.
+               Writing '0' to this file will disable offloading copies for this
+               device, instead copy is done via emulation.
+
+
+What:          /sys/block/<disk>/queue/copy_max_hw_bytes
+Date:          May 2024
+Contact:       linux-bl...@vger.kernel.org
+Description:
+               [RO] This is the maximum number of bytes that the hardware
+               will allow for single data copy request.
+               A value of 0 means that the device does not support
+               copy offload.
